Colorado's climate, with its thin air, intense sun, and extreme temperature swings, puts unique stress on garage doors. The altitude can affect opener performance, and rapid temperature changes can cause materials to expand and contract, leading to wear. Snow and ice buildup in winter can also strain springs and cables. Regular maintenance is essential to combat these effects.
